Featuring a post-screening discussion with Andrea Warner, author of THE TIME OF MY LIFE: DIRTY DANCING, hosted by Alexis Kienlen.

Baby (Jennifer Grey) is one listless summer away from the Peace Corps. Hoping to enjoy her youth while it lasts, she’s disappointed when her summer plans deposit her at a sleepy resort in the Catskills with her parents. Her luck turns around, however, when the resort’s dance instructor, Johnny (Patrick Swayze), enlists Baby as his new partner, and the two fall in love. Baby’s father forbids her from seeing Johnny, but she’s determined to help him perform the last big dance of the summer.

Andrea Warner writes and talks. A lot. She’s the author of four books including her newest work, The Time of My Life: Dirty Dancing (ECW). An expanded and revised edition of her first book, We Oughta Know: How Céline, Shania, Alanis, and Sarah Ruled the ’90s and Changed Music, will be released fall 2024, also from ECW. Andrea is the co-host of the weekly feminist podcast Pop This! and an associate producer at CBC Music. Andrea is a settler who was born and raised in Vancouver on the unceded traditional territories of the Musqueam, Squamish, and Tsleil-Waututh First Nations.

Alexis Kienlen is a mixed race poet, journalist, and fiction writer who has lived in Edmonton for about 16 years. She is the author of four books, and a long-time lover of movies. The first movie she saw in the theatre was The Black Stallion.
